Meeting Point and Transportation
The meeting point for the private Osuwa Daiko performance is the Lawson Venus-Line Shirakabako Shop, located at 1570-1 Ashidahakkano, Tateshina, Kitasaku District, Nagano 384-2309, Japan. To get there, take the Alpico Kotsu Suwa-Shirakabako Line bus from the Chino Station West Exit Bus Terminal towards Kurumayama Kogen, and get off at the Higashi-Shirakabako bus stop, which is an 8-stop journey. From the bus stop, it’s a 3-minute walk to the meeting point. The activity concludes at the same location.
From | To | Duration | Distance |
---|---|---|---|
Chino Station West Exit Bus Terminal | Higashi-Shirakabako bus stop | 8 stops | – |
Higashi-Shirakabako bus stop | Lawson Venus-Line Shirakabako Shop | 3 minutes | 210 meters |

Cancellation Policy and Refunds
The cancellation policy for the private Osuwa Daiko performance is straightforward.
Tours may be canceled due to unsafe conditions like snow, typhoons, or heavy rain, as well as light rain that could affect the drum skins.
Since this is a private tour, only your group will participate, and there are no refunds for cancellations.
The price is $873.39 per group (up to 10 people).
